Most wind projects are shaped by terrain, roughness and atmospheric stability. In these conditions, modelling assumptions directly influence wind inputs, wake losses and yield outcomes. Whiffle Atlas and Whiffle Wind are designed to represent these effects explicitly, from early-stage screening through to yield assessment.Whiffle Atlas provides the long-term wind climate.Whiffle Wind resolves how that wind behaves at your site. Together, they provide consistent inputs for wind resource and yield assessment.

Whiffle Atlas

Site screening, regional wind characterisation, long-term context for yield assumptions

21 years of mesoscale wind time series at 2 km resolution. Near-zero mean wind speed bias across all terrain types. Preview site wind statistics (wind rose, Weibull distribution, vertical shear profile) instantly and for free. Download the full time series for sites that make your shortlist. 

Whiffle Wind

Wind resource assessment, wake modelling, bankable yield

Atmospheric LES (Whiffle LES) at 100 m resolution (or less), driven by ERA5 and Whiffle’s own meso model. Turbines explicitly in the domain. Outputs WRGs, full hourly time series and per-turbine AEP, compatible with wind resource assessment tools like WindPRO and OpenWind.
